Chronicles of the Royal Family of Bonai (Odisha) (Studies in Orissan Society, Culture and History #13)

Synopsis

The chronicles of the royal family of Bonai—now a sub-division of Sundargarh district in Odisha—are memories of the past complex relations between overlords and tribal chiefs and between gods and communities. The chronicles were produced, modified and fabricated under specific historic circumstances stimulated by internal and external factors. They reflect the wider socio-religious context that in turn shaped them. They begin with the conquering of the realm by the first raja from where the kingdom of Bonai commenced to later times. They throw light on the rich socio-cultural and religious history of the land. This volume presents the chronicles of the former kingdom of Bonai referring to a variety of texts on the history of Bonai. It presents the original Oriya text of the chronicles and their English translation.
